What does Capric Triglycerides do in a cosmetic formula?
This ingredient is a lightweight emollient and oil-phase solvent that improves slip, reduces greasiness, and helps disperse lipophilic actives, pigments, and fragrance components.
Is Capric Triglycerides clean?
It is generally well tolerated, low in sensitization concerns, and broadly accepted in clean-beauty frameworks. Clean-standard scrutiny is usually about feedstock origin and trace processing impurities rather than the molecule itself.
Is Capric Triglycerides sustainable?
This material is commonly derived from coconut or palm-kernel oil, so responsible sourcing matters, especially for palm-linked supply chains. It is readily biodegradable and does not raise the persistence concerns associated with many synthetic silicones or fluorinated materials.
Is Capric Triglycerides COSMOS-approved?
It is typically permitted under COSMOS-natural and COSMOS-organic standards when made from approved renewable feedstocks using compliant processing. Its Green Chemistry profile is strong because it can be plant-derived, biodegradable, low in irritation potential, and made through relatively straightforward esterification or interesterification chemistry.
How does Capric Triglycerides work chemically?
The molecule is a neutral triester built from glycerol and predominantly C10 fatty-acid chains, giving it low polarity, low odor, and a dry, fast-spreading skin feel. It is stable across typical cosmetic pH ranges because it sits in the oil phase, but it can hydrolyze under strongly acidic or alkaline conditions and is usually used from low single-digit levels up to much higher levels in anhydrous oils and balms.
